Specifications include, but are not limited to: The Department of Land and Natural Resources (DLNR), Division of Aquatic Resources (DAR) requires office facilities at three separate locations around the state. 1. New construction temporary/mobile office workspace 32’ long x 10’ wide office trailer. 2. Shall include at a minimum: a. One centrally located 3ft wide personnel door with window and deadbolt; b. Two 4ft x 3ft double pane windows on the wall opposite the door; c. Four 4ft x 3ft double pane windows on the wall with the door; d. One exterior security light adjacent to personnel door; e. Water and scratch resistant flooring. f. Fiber reinforced plastic (FRP) interior wall paneling. g. 125A electrical capacity with breaker panel; h. Minimum eight overhead recessed LED light fixtures (or equivalent); i. Minimum twelve duplex 110V outlets; j. Data/cable pass through; 5. For the Kona mobile office only: a.
